Laser induced fluorescence diagnostics of simple radicals in atmospheric pressure plasma jets

Dilecce Giorgio;Ambrico Paolo Francesco;De Benedictis Santolo
2015

Abstract

In this paper we give a general description of the LIF technique by way of OH absolute measurements in two atmospheric pressure plasma jet systems, namely a plasma gun and a RF plasma jet. We address in detail: the modelling of the LIF measurement, taking into account collisional processes and the spatial non-uniformity of the laser beam; absolute calibration; rotational temperature measurements.
